Page Last Updated Module

Time Tracker Icon

This module uses a template that you define to display the date and/or time that the current page was last updated. Out of the box, this module interfaces with the Text\HTML and Links modules to calculate the last updated time; however, it is also very extendable and allows you to add your own code to interface with any module that tracks the last time it was updated. To do this is usually as easy as developing one simple method.

We have created an extension that works with the Annoucements module to demonstrate how easy it is to interface with any module.

If you would prefer it also allows you to use a SQL query to retrieve the date you would like to include in the calculation simply by entering it into the "Manage Commands" page of the module.

 

System Requirments:
DotNetNuke 4.9+
.Net Framework 3.5+
 * note running this module on DotNetNuke 5.1.x requires additional configuration please see the instructions below.

Instructions for running this module on DotNetNuke 5.1+

1. Download and extract the ITLackey.Modules.PageLastUpdated.HtmlCommand.zip file to a folder on your PC.
2. Login as a superuser (host) and go to the "Manage Commands" screen of the module.
3. Upload the extracted dll file under the "Upload Assemblies" section.
4. Click the "Edit" link next to "Text\HTML"
5. Uncheck the "Enabled" check box
6. Click "Update"
